In this solo episode of the Check Your Brain podcast, Tony Mazur goes through the archives of how pop songs are intended to sound timeless, as they are mainly used to sell products. He also explores why, in the Napster/LimeWire universe, artists may be purposely putting out mediocre crap because they know they will barely see a dime in royalties.
